Mohler named HCAC Player of the Week
BLUFFTON, Ohio - Bluffton University’s Sydney Mohler (Lima, Ohio/Central Catholic) helped the Beavers post sweeps of Earlham and Goshen during the week and has been named the Heartland Collegiate Athletic Conference Volleyball Player of the Week on defense.
It marks the third straight week that a Beaver has been named the HCAC Player of the Week, following back-to-back honors for Jenny Brown (St. Marys/Memorial) on offense.
The sophomore libero picked up 37 digs and averaged 6.2 digs per set in the two victories. Mohler also chipped in with eight assists and four service aces in the wins.
Bluffton (11-6, 2-0 HCAC) will host rival Defiance at 7 p.m. on Wednesday before traveling south to face Transylvania at Lexington, Ky., on Friday evening.
